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017) has an overall score of 65.7, which is much better than the OnePlus Pad's 56.7 global score. These devices come with Android OS, but the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017) has 9.0 Pie version while OnePlus Pad has Android 13 version, providing you some additional features.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017) is a much older and way thicker portable tablet than the OnePlus Pad, but Samsung managed to build it much lighter anyway.
The Samsung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017) has a much better performance than OnePlus Pad, although it has a lower number of cores and lesser RAM. OnePlus Pad features an incredibly better looking display than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017), because it has a much higher 2000 x 2800 resolution, a way larger screen and a lot more pixels per display inch.
The OnePlus Pad counts with a much better memory for games and applications than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017), because although it has no external SD slot, it also counts with 112 GB more internal storage capacity. The OnePlus Pad features a really longer battery life than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017), because it has a 90 percent more battery capacity.
The Galaxy Tab A 8.0 (2017) shoots clearer photos and videos than OnePlus Pad, because although it has a back camera with a way lower 8 MP resolution, it also counts with a bigger aperture for better captures and videos in low light situations.
